Transaction 3d434fa39bf79e67a1dd21245f10866ef38e556bf5f4b5051203db53648730c5

2 Input
2 Outputs
  • 3d434fa39bf79e67a1dd21245f10866ef38e556bf5f4b5051203db53648730c5:0
  • value  21153229
    address  1JopCDdQtw5v7cX855LesUviSa6sg2dKJx
  • 3d434fa39bf79e67a1dd21245f10866ef38e556bf5f4b5051203db53648730c5:1
  • value  1135310
    address  3KSAwGG5pQ3L693ek8vCR2veTuZc6vMadM